Frequently Asked Questions
 

What is an SEO press release?

An SEO press release or 'search engine optimized' press release is first and foremost a way to deliver news of new events taking place within a company. However, it is written in such a way that it will rank well in the search engines for target keywords and provide the company website with important backlinks that will also help boost it's position in the search engine rankings.

What are the most common mistakes people make when submitting press releases?

  • Writing weak headlines - They will become the title tag, so it is important that they are engaging as well as keyword optimized.
  • Not having a newsworthy angle - Press releases are not supposed to be a big advertisement for a company. Their purpose is and has always been to convey the news.
  • Not using quotes - Quotes are wonderful opportunities to personalize a release and include promotional material that would otherwise not be suited for the body of a release.

Why would a company want to distribute news online if they only target a local market?

In the online world, it doesn't matter where a business is located. A local pest control company in Chicago, for instance, will still want to rank high for the search term "pest control Chicago." Submitting regular press releases that target that keyword and use it in anchor text is an excellent way to increase rankings. In addition, many online journalists are able to customize their news feeds to only include local news if they wish -- so the pest control company would still essentially be targeting their proper market.
